This reads as if this patch is handling SError RAS notifications generated by a CPU with the RAS extensions. These are about CPU->Software notifications. APEI and GHES are a firmware first mechanism which is Software->Software. Reading the v8.2 documents won't help anyone with the APEI/GHES code. Please describe this from the ACPI view, "ACPI 6.x adds support for NOTIFY_SEI as a GHES notification mechanism... ", its up to the arch code to spot a v8.2 RAS Error based on the cpu caps. > This error source parsing and handling method > is similar with the SEA. There are problems with doing this: Oct. 18, 2017, 10:26 a.m. James Morse wrote: | How do SEA and SEI interact? | | As far as I can see they can both interrupt each other, which isn't something | the single in_nmi() path in APEI can handle. I thinks we should fix this | first. [..] | SEA gets away with a lot of things because its synchronous. SEI isn't. Xie | XiuQi pointed to the memory_failure_queue() code. We can use this directly | from SEA, but not SEI. (what happens if an SError arrives while we are | queueing memory_failure work from an IRQ). | | The one that scares me is the trace-point reporting stuff. What happens if an | SError arrives while we are enabling a trace point? (these are static-keys | right?) | | I don't think we can just plumb SEI in like this and be done with it. | (I'm looking at teasing out the estatus cache code from being x86:NMI only. | This way we solve the same 'cant do this from NMI context' with the same | code'.)
